Hello, I have a waters refractive index detector that was recently resurrected from the supply closet. The problem is that I have no idea how to qualify it (we're in the pharmaceutical industry). I've done some looking but have not found anything yet. We need to get the OQ/PQ done quickly, so any help would be greatly appreciated.

ASTM has a standard practice for RI detectors (E1303-95) that should work for you. You can get it from ASTM:

Waters does have an IQ/OQ/PQ document set for RI detectors that can be ordered directly from Waters. The part number is 71550241001 call 1 800 252 4752 for any additional information.
